About the role

  • Cyber Security Engineer supporting mission-critical DoD contract at CACI. Involves reviewing infrastructure changes and implementing security measures in a cloud-based environment.

Responsibilities

  • serve as information security specialist
  • review all software, hardware, and infrastructure changes on the contracts
  • follow the risk management framework process to support system accreditation
  • maintain security documentation
  • using forensic tools for attack reconstructions
  • work with development teams to create, maintain, and monitor data connections
  • apply cloud, network, and security best practices
  • implement and improve DevSecOps process maintained in Linux/Cloud based development environment
  • architect security infrastructure as needed to protect against cyber attacks

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in information systems, systems engineering, electrical engineering, information technology, or related field with 5+ years of relevant experience
  • Bachelor’s degree in information systems, systems engineering, electrical engineering, information technology, or related field with 7+ years of relevant experience
  • Subject matter expertise with DOD/IC system security control requirements
  • Subject matter expert level knowledge of system security engineering principles and IT technologies such as firewalls, encryption, and proxies.
